gpt4 book ai didi

javascript - 如何向在javascript中动态添加的按钮数组添加点击功能?

转载 作者:太空宇宙 更新时间:2023-11-04 00:29:15 26 4
gpt4 key购买 nike

代码如下:

for(var i=0;i<quick_r.length;i++) {

quick_messages[i] = '<button type="button" class="quick" id="quick' + quick_count + '">'+quick_r[i]["title"]+ '</button>';
quick_count++;
replyID[i] = '#quick'+quick_count;
console.log(replyID[i]);
}

我想在循环中为该按钮添加一个单击功能,该功能是根据 Quick_r 的数量动态生成的我借助该循环动态地将 Id 添加到按钮

最佳答案

在 jQuery 1.7+ 中,您可以使用 .on() 将事件处理程序附加到父元素,并将选择器与类作为参数传递。

$('parentTag').on('click', 'quick', function() {
//do some work.
});

将动态创建的按钮添加到父标记内,或者也可以传递“body”标记。

关于javascript - 如何向在javascript中动态添加的按钮数组添加点击功能?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/41628710/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com